Viagra acts as a prescription medication used to treat erectile dysfunction in men. It works by increasing blood flow to the penis, which helps to achieve and maintain an erection during sexual activity. It's important to note that Viagra is not a love drug and does not trigger spontaneous erections. It should only be taken when preparing for sexual intercourse.
Side effects of Viagra can include flushing, indigestion, and altered vision. While these side effects are usually mild and temporary, it's important to consult with a doctor if you experience any uncomfortable side effects.

Understanding Viagra: Dosage, Uses, and Precautions
Viagra is a popular treatment prescribed to address erectile dysfunction in men. It works by increasing blood flow to the penis, making it more feasible to achieve and maintain an erection. When taking Viagra, it's crucial to follow your doctor's instructions carefully. The typical starting dose is 25 milligrams taken about one hour before sexual activity.
It's important to note that Viagra shouldn't be taken more than once per day, and it should never be paired with other medications for erectile dysfunction without your doctor's consent.
Some common side effects of Viagra include headache, flushing, indigestion, and nasal congestion. These are usually moderate and tend to subside on their own. However, if you experience any serious side effects, seek medical assistance immediately.
- Prior to taking Viagra, it's essential to inform your doctor about any existing medical conditions you may have, including heart disease, low blood pressure, or a history of stroke.
- Furthermore, tell your doctor about all the drugs you're currently taking. This includes prescription drugs, over-the-counter medications, vitamins, and herbal supplements.
Viagra can be a helpful solution for erectile dysfunction, but it's crucial to use it safely. Always speak with your doctor before starting Viagra or making any changes to your existing plan.
